Given Input Data is 770, 270, 326, 895
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ially
Prime Factorization of 770 is 2 x 5 x 7 x 11
Prime Factorization of 270 is 2 x 3 x 3 x 3 x 5
Prime Factorization of 326 is 2 x 163
Prime Factorization of 895 is 5 x 179
The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
